Today's Premier League Transfer Gossip


. Borussia Dortmund striker Robert Lewandowski, 24, is set to turn down a move to Manchester United is favour of staying in Germany and switching to Bayern Munich for 25m pounds.Congrat to other premier league team fans, can't imagine the goal machine and Van persie upfront.
. According to UK the sun : Chelsea could land manager Jose Mourinho on the cheap this summer and get former Liverpool midfielder Xabi Alonso, 31, as well if the Real Madrid coach returns to Stamford Bridge.
. However, it could cost the Blues 200m to appoint him as manager when taking into account the escape clause in his contract and the players he wants to sign. He has been Categorically told he will have to work under Nigerian technical director Michael Emenalo if he wants  to return to Chelsea.




. Manchester City could make Shakhtar Donetsk midfielder Fernandinho, 27, the first signing of their summer.
. Aston Villa are ready to turn down offers of 30m pounds in an effort to keep hold of 22 year old striker Christian Benteke. 
. Liverpool and Manchester United face another contender for the signature of Torino defender Angelo Ogbonna, 24, with Bayern Munich now on his trail.
. Tottenham are hopeful of signing long-term target Leandro Damiao with the Brazil striker, 23, set to leave Internacional for Europe, with Napoli also expressing interest.
. Chelsea have opened the door on a one year contract extension for Frank Lampard,34 , just four months after the mid-fielder's agent claimed that ''in no circumstances'' would his player be offered a new deal.
. Cardiff want to make £7m-rated Stoke striker Kenwyne Jones, 28, their first Premier League signing.
. Galatasaray are ready to offer Arsenal 15m pounds for Germany forward Lukas Podolski,27 , making him their top targt.
